Our Properties NeueHouse currently operates across four different, but equally iconic properties in New York City and Los Angeles: Our Madison Square (MSQ) House is situated in New York's iconic Flatiron District, was previously home for Tepper Galleries, a well-known Manhattan auction house for international artists and collectors in the 1930s - and neighbors the 69th Regiment Armory where the first International Exhibition of Modern Art was held. Our Hollywood House (HWD) , which sits on Sunset Boulevard, is one of LA's most celebrated buildings and occupies the original CBS Studio (the world's first structure built intentionally for broadcast). Here genre- defining artists from Orson Wells and Lucille Ball to Janis Joplin, the Beach Boys, and Bob Dylan built their legacy. Our Bradbury House (BB) sits within the Bradbury building in DTLA. Built in 1893, the Bradbury Building is an architectural masterpiece and one of Los Angeles' most historic landmarks. It has been heralded as one of the most thrilling spaces in all North America and is renowned for its breathtaking skylit atrium filled with walkways, stairs, balconies, and intricate ironwork. Our Venice Beach House (VB) was once the creative home to some of the most influential creative luminaries in art and entertainment including Hal Ashby, Oliver Stone, and David Hockney, NeueHouse Venice Beach is a new work, social, and cultural hub for the Venice creative community.
